🌟 Introduction to Agile Software Development

Agile software development is an umbrella term for approaches to developing software that reflect the values and principles agreed upon by The Agile Alliance, a group of 17 software practitioners, in 2001. As documented in their Manifesto for Agile Software Development, the practitioners value: Individuals and interactions over processes and tools, Working software over comprehensive documentation, Customer collaboration over contract negotiation, and Responding to change over following a plan. This approach has been widely adopted in the software industry, with many companies incorporating agile methodologies such as Scrum and Kanban into their development processes. 📝 The Agile Manifesto: Core Values and Principles

The Agile Manifesto is a foundational document that outlines the core values and principles of agile software development. The manifesto was created by a group of 17 software practitioners, including Kent Beck and Jeff Sutherland, who are considered to be among the founders of the agile movement. The manifesto emphasizes the importance of individuals and interactions over processes and tools, and working software over comprehensive documentation. It also highlights the need for customer collaboration and responding to change. 📊 Working Software: The Primary Measure of Progress

Working software is the primary measure of progress in agile software development. This approach emphasizes the importance of delivering working software in short iterations, rather than focusing on comprehensive documentation. Agile teams use various techniques, such as test-driven development and continuous integration, to ensure that the software is working as intended. This approach allows for faster time-to-market and increased customer satisfaction. 📈 Customer Collaboration: A Key to Successful Projects

Customer collaboration is a key aspect of agile software development. This approach emphasizes the importance of working closely with customers and stakeholders to understand their needs and deliver value. Agile teams use various techniques, such as user stories and acceptance tests, to ensure that the software meets the customer's requirements. This approach allows for increased customer satisfaction and return on investment.
